Haut-Mauco (40), February 21, 2025. The Board of Directors of MAS Seeds® has appointed Arnaud TACHON as its Chairman since February 3, 2025. He succeeds Jean-Luc CAPES, who remains President of the Maïsadour Seed Producers Group (GPSM) and member of the Board of Directors of MAS Seeds®. For over 50 years, our Haut-Mauco facility in the Landes region has played a central role in producing maize, sunflower, and oilseed rape seeds.
